About the Role

This role manages the marketing calendar, leads the internal marketing team, coordinates campaigns, supports sales enablement, oversees events, manages internal communications, and ensures marketing work is completed on time and aligned with brand standards. It is a hands-on leadership role for a practical marketing operator who can manage people, organize priorities, support multiple operating companies, and jump into the work when needed.
